SSG is a Static Site Generator that is only a Static Site Generator. No resumes here! Just a piece of code that generates static files from templates for websites, and can do it live while you develop said templates.

package main
import (
"log"
"fmt"
"strings"
"io/fs"
"path/filepath"
"os"
"github.com/gofiber/fiber/v2"
"github.com/gofiber/template/html/v2"
"zedshaw.games/ssgod/config"
"github.com/yuin/goldmark"
)
func Fail(err error, format string, v ...any) error {
err_format := fmt.Sprintf("ERROR: %v; %s", err, format)
log.Printf(err_format, v...)
return err
}
func ProcessDirEntry(engine *html.Engine, path string, d fs.DirEntry, err error) error {
settings := config.Settings
if !d.IsDir() {
if err != nil { return Fail(err, "path: %s", path); }
dir := filepath.Dir(path)
err = os.MkdirAll(dir, 0750)
if err != nil {
return Fail(err, "making dir %s", dir);
}
split_path := strings.Split(path, string(os.PathSeparator))[1:]
source_name := strings.Join(split_path, "/") // Render wants / even on windows
ext := filepath.Ext(source_name)
source_name, found := strings.CutSuffix(source_name, ext)
if found && source_name != settings.Layout {
prefixed_path := append([]string{settings.Target}, split_path...)
target_path := filepath.Join(prefixed_path...)
_, err := os.Stat(target_path)
if os.IsNotExist(err) {
target_dir := filepath.Dir(target_path)
log.Println("MAKING: ", target_dir)
os.MkdirAll(target_dir, 0750)
}
// generate a data-testid for all pages based on template name
page_id := strings.ReplaceAll(source_name, "/", "-") + "-page"
if ext == ".html" {
out, err := os.OpenFile(target_path, os.O_RDWR|os.O_CREATE|os.O_TRUNC, 0644)
defer out.Close()
if err != nil { return Fail(err, "writing file %s", target_path) }
err = engine.Render(out, source_name, fiber.Map{"PageId": page_id}, settings.Layout)
if err != nil { return Fail(err, "failed to render %s", path) }
log.Printf("RENDER: %s -> %s", source_name, target_path)
} else if ext == ".md" {
// need to strip the .md and replace with .html
html_name, _ := strings.CutSuffix(target_path, ext)
html_name = fmt.Sprintf("%s.html", html_name)
log.Printf("MARKDOWN: %s -> %s", path, html_name)
out, err := os.OpenFile(html_name, os.O_RDWR|os.O_CREATE|os.O_TRUNC, 0644)
defer out.Close()
if err != nil { return Fail(err, "writing file %s", target_path) }
input_data, err := os.ReadFile(path)
err = goldmark.Convert(input_data, out)
if err != nil { return Fail(err, "failed to render markdown %s", path) }
}
}
}
return nil
}
func RenderPages() {
engine := html.New(config.Settings.Views, ".html")
engine.Load()
err := filepath.WalkDir(config.Settings.Views,
func (path string, d fs.DirEntry, err error) error {
return ProcessDirEntry(engine, path, d, err)
})
if err != nil { log.Fatalf("can't walk content") }
}
func main() {
config.Load("ssgod.toml")
RenderPages()
}
